Reporting ToProject Operations Manager
In this role, the Project Scheduler takes ownership in collaborating with project teams and suppliers to develop and manage project schedules effectively. This role involves leading scheduling efforts across all project phases, performing risk analysis, identifying critical paths, and implementing mitigation strategies to ensure projects are delivered on time. The scheduler will support the Project Manager in communications with suppliers and customers on project status and timelines, ensure cohesive project execution and foster strong relationships.

Role & Responsibilities- Develop and consult on the initial project schedule by incorporating key milestones and tasks from various phases such as proposal, execution, manufacturing, delivery, and close‑out, including interfacing to supplier and customer dates.
- Lead scheduling activities with internal and external suppliers as the main point of contact, ensuring effective communication and information sharing among the project team and stakeholders.
- Collaborate with the project team to analyze requirements, risks, and scope changes, ensuring all essential activities are detailed for realistic project schedules.
- Monitor progress and critical paths, notify Project Managers of deviations or scheduling issues and provide recommendations to keep critical activities and milestones on track.
- Issue regular schedule reports and program updates, establish project baselines and provide analytics to monitor progress against key targets.
- Actively participate in project reviews to assess progress and address any issues that arise.
- Coordinate with procurement to ensure materials are ordered on time to meet schedule commitments.
- Perform critical‑path analysis and help establish mitigation plans, hold suppliers accountable for execution plans, challenging supplier performance versus initial schedules.
